How do you manually open the hood on a 1993 Plymouth Voyager Van when the release is broken?

We get this from time to time. Usually you can get to the mechanism unless it has a guard over it. Then you have to have patience and luck. Find the cable where it comes out to the grill and try to disconnect the cable jacket from where it is held onto the latch. Then pull the whole cable, inside and out, together as a unit. Don't let the inner core move independently from the outer sheath. The idea is to grab the whole cable and pull on it and the latch should open. You have to disconnect the outer sheath from where it is attached to the latch for this to work. Sometimes you can remove the grill and see where the latch bolts on. Then remove the bolts and the hood and latch will come up as an assembly. Then you can unlatch the hood from the latch once everything is out in the open and visible.

"IN my case the cable actually came out of the latch. So I could pull on that sucker till the cows came home, but it wasn't gong to help. I just removed the front grill plastic. Four little torx head screws and then I unlatched it with a screw driver. Took about 20 minutes."

That answer worked perfectly! Then I cut away the plastic shroud inside the car around the broken lever and removed the lever mounting bracket (three hex head screws) with a socket and ratchet. Then exposed a couple of inches of cable by cutting away the wire reinforced plastic sleeve. Then clamped an inexpensive pair of locking pliers to the bare cable such that it would not only be handy for releasing the latch in the future, but also to serve as a weight to prevent any slack in the cable from causing the other end to jump out of the hood latch again. Also, make sure that the rubber grommet is still properly seated in the firewall hole to keep dangerous fumes from entering the passenger space. It is easily accessed from the inside.

How do you drain fluid in front differential on 1995 Chevrolet astro van awd?

Jack up vehicle loosen the 10 differential bolts using a screwdriver pry off pressed steel cove allow oil to drain , clean metal magnet off located inside diff cover, clean both mating sides to cover and differential housing, replace with a gasket which you buy at the local parts dealer with 80/90 weight gear oil, put gasket on torqued to specified tightness, remove check fill plug passenger side differential fill to the quantity specs and that it (note use a wheel blocking system before performing this task 1/2 inch socket required to take differential bolts off , gasket costs $6.00 same as rtv sealer but way easier and less messy to use.

How do you fix P0560 code 2004 venture?

Hi,

That particular code - P0560 - says that the PCM (Powertrain Control Module or "engine computer") has detected that the "System Voltage" is not correct.

This usually means that either your battery is going bad, or you have a poor connection between the battery and the PCM - at the monitoring point. What you will need is to test the battery - at least as a starting point - and then move on from there.

How do you remove the exterior handle of the sliding door on a 1988 Chevy Vandura 20?

I'm not sure if a "88 Vandura is the same as a 91 Chevy G20 but here goes anyway... Once you've removed the side sliding door interior handle and cover plate you will notice a square "rod" sticking through the middle of the door hardware. This "rod" is where the interior door handle was attached. It goes through a round piece that holds the door hardware together. The square "rod" is an extension of the exterior door handle. No matter how hard you try,you can not pull the exterior door handle off of its shaft. The only way to remove the handle is cut it off but you don't want to do that. It is possible to remove the exterior door handle and shaft from the hardware but it ain't easy....... Here's what you do..... The exterior door handle and hardware were assembled at the Chevy plant and not meant to come apart or break for that matter. That is why it is so difficult to remove the exterior handle and shaft....it was "pressed in" at the factory.... What you do is get a small "bearing puller" that will fit around the shaft and against the handle. Also get 2 6" pieces of redi rod that screw into the bearing puller. Get 2 nuts for each redi rod. You'll also need something to protect your door when you screw down on it with the redi rod. I used 2 pieces of 1/8" sheet metal about 8" long and 4" wide. Maybe something thin like cardboard or sheet rubber should be used between the sheet metal and door to protect the paint. Once you've got it set up just turn the bolts on the redi rod and it will slowly come out. You may want to give the rod a tap with a hammer once in a while..... When you get the unit out, you can file all sides down so it will go back in easier. You don't have to file much. Keep the corners square. Don't give up, you can do it.....
